WebApr 3, 2024 · To make honey glazed ham, preheat your oven to 325°F (165°C). While the oven is heating up, remove the ham from its packaging and place it in a roasting pan. Score the surface of the ham in a diamond pattern, about 1/4 inch deep. The scoring will allow the glaze to penetrate the ham and create a more flavorful end result. WebDec 12, 2024 · Common Glaze Ingredients Some common ingredients used in making a ham glaze include: Jam or preserves Brown sugar Honey Maple syrup Fruit juice, cider or soda Mustard Vinegar Cloves, cinnamon, ginger, and other spices The idea of making the glaze is to combine the ingredients into a paste, looking to balance the sweet, tangy and …
